Tax relief is available for private health and long-term care insurance. It is also available for certain medical expenses. Older people's tax credits and reliefs. Special taxation arrangements apply to people aged 65 and over. Webb27 apr. 2024 · Ireland will continue to apply the 12.5% corporation tax rate to companies with global turnover below this threshold. The 15% rate is expected to apply to roughly 1,500 businesses in Ireland. For most taxpayers, circa 160,000 businesses, there should be no change if these proposals are introduced. How will the Digital Games Tax Credit scheme work? baumelouWebb16 juni 2024 · In 2010 Social Justice Ireland published a detailed study on the subject of refundable tax credits. Entitled Building a Fairer Tax System: The Working Poor and the Cost of Refundable Tax Credits, the study identified that the proposed system would at that time benefit 113,000 low-income individuals in an efficient and cost-effective manner. baumeler leitungsbau ag perlen
